ISO 2017 All rights reserved vBS EN ISO 9241960:2017ISO 9241-960:2017(E)IntroductionTactile and haptic interactions are becoming increasingly importan

    45、t as candidate interaction modalities in computer systems such as special purpose computing environments (e.g. tablets), wearable technology (e.g. tactile arrays, instrumented gloves), and assistive technologies.Tactile and haptic devices are being developed in university and industrial laboratories

    46、 in many countries. Both the developer and the prospective purchaser of such devices need a means of making comparisons between competing devices and common design of interactions.This document focuses on gestures and identification of gesture sets as a specific type of tactile/haptic interaction. I

    47、t explains how to describe their features, and what factors to take into account when defining gestures.ISO 9241-910 provides a common set of terms, definitions and descriptions of the various concepts central to designing and using tactile/haptic interactions. It also provides an overview of the ra

    48、nge of tactile/haptic applications, objects, attributes, and interactions.ISO 9241-920 provides basic guidance (including references to related standards) in the design of tactile/haptic interactions.ISO 9241-940 (under preparation) is to provide ways of evaluating tactile/haptic interactions for va
